In a bid to attract new customers into the fun and excitement of horse racing, some of Britain's best known racecourses have teamed up to create the first ever week when the public can race for free every day. Race horses 2

This ground breaking initiative throughout April 2010 is being organised by Racing for Change as part of a wider campaign to broaden the appeal of the sport. Eight racecourses, over a period of six days between Monday 26 April and Saturday 1 May, will open their gates and welcome visitors free of charge so they can experience the thrill of a day at the races.

At each of the free race meetings, free guides to the racing will be handed out by the Tote so that every visitor will have a list of the runners and riders.

*Racing for Change is a new initiative created by Racing Enterprises Ltd, the commercial arm of British horse racing. The Racing for Change board features all of the sport's key organisations and includes not only representation from the racecourses and the participants, but also the Horse race Betting Levy Board and the British Horseracing Authority, the bodies with responsibility for funding, governance and regulation.
